Seattle has a landmark library. It is glass, and beautiful. They put in an "Up" escalator that rises majestically through to the 9th floor. Due to budgetary constraints, they did not install a "Down" escalator, so you get to queue up at one of the few elevators, or take the rather unimpressive fire stairs back down. A classic case of function following form. A rather boring and much cheaper conventional building would have been adequate and they could have afforded a "Down" escalator.

My fourth grade teacher Mr. Simpson, freshly returned from a stint serving in the Viet Nam war, would often take our class on "nature walks" around our suburban school on beautiful sunny days.

Once the administration became aware of these walks, they put the kibosh on them, insisting that each child's parents sign a consent form and waiver prior.

Since it is difficult to detect well in advance what the weather is going to be, and since those children whose parents did not sign the waivers had to stay at the school and be tended by a second teacher...the nature walks ceased.

Another innocent, innocuous activity strangled by a bureaucracy and the liability lawyers.
